    Soggy lettuce leaves and stalk!  Unexpired salad but funky tasting
    Fatima E.

    Wasn't expecting a gourmet salad but the item that didn't leave my refrigerator overnight, until lunch the next day proved to be a mistake. The salad leaves had stalks, the edges were browned and when I set these aside to at least enjoy the cucumber and shrimp, it tasted off. So much for a reliable healthy lunch. Another purchase two months ago was for a large bag of acid reduced Coffee beans (Puroast). I didn't open this till recently only to discover it had expired over six months ago. When I told the cashier she said they can't exchange or give credit without a receipt. What's the point of the Smith's card? if they can give me coupons based on my recent purchases why couldn't they find this item. They'll also see that these are the first items I've ever exchanged since I signed up. Smith's is no longer the same supermarket they used to be.

    Smith's policy to not allow Starbucks baristas to accept tips.
    Lisa H.

    Why is it Smith's policy to not allow their Starbucks baristas to accept tips anymore? Tipping is the customer's prerogative. This takes $1-$2 per hour out of their pockets and I'm sure Smith's didn't raise their pay to compensate for this loss of income. I tried to tip and was told they were threatened with termination if they accepted. What exactly does this policy accomplish and who benefits from it? As the customer, I don't appreciate being told how I can spend my own money. Hopefully Smith's corporate will realize how abundantly ignorant this policy is and recind it in the future. All it does is rob these workers of any potential extra income.

    Great price!
    Mike F.

    Bumping this up a star because it has gotten better in recent months. I mean, I still prefer Albertsons up the road on Rainbow, but this place can have some really good deals from time to time. Just today they had 6- pack, 16 ounce bottles of Pepsi products for basically $2 each! (5 - 6 packs for $10) and 4 - 2liter bottles 4 bottles for $5! They can also have outstanding specials on frozen goods, lunch meats, and beer! You just have to keep your eyes peeled for the flyers with all the specials. Parking still sucks. Service has been hit or miss over the years, but lately it has been a lot more "hit" than "miss". A solid back up location that happens to be nearby, Smiths isn't necessarily my first choice, but it can be good in a pinch. 3 stars. A-Ok.

    So apparently this place had changed ownership a few years back. The store front is still the same…read morename; Asian Market, so not sure why on Yelp I found it under Orient Pearl Asian Market. I was actually next door, picking up a sandwich, when I decided to go in and check it out since I haven't been here in a good few years. Imagine my surprise when the interior has changed and with new items! For me, I was very pleased to find that there was practically almost everything I would need to make some Hawaii local food. Definitely saves me a trip to International. The lady (owner?) told me that every other week, they get a shipment of produce and food items from Hawaii. They had Hawaiian chili peppers (which I used to make a huge batch of chili peppa watah), frozen Opihi, and fresh luau leaves at $5.99/lb to name just a few items. I bought a couple bags of luau and I can vouch that the luau leaves were good pieces and cleaned. In the back of the store, they had hot food. It looked (and smelled) really good. I didn't buy any because I was holding a bag with the sandwich I bought next store, but I will definitely come back and try the food next time.
